The Investor to hold seminar on green credit, green bond legal framework on Wednesday
The Investor will hold a seminar on green credit and green bonds on Wednesday (April 3) in a bid to discuss ways to remove bottlenecks in the legal framework and boost market development.

The Investor will hold a seminar on green finance on April 3, 2024. Photo courtesy of energysavingtrust.
The event, themed “A matter of urgency: Completing the legal framework to develop green credit, green bonds”, is a collaboration between The Investor and the Institute of Strategy and Policy on Natural Resources and Environment, under the Ministry of Natural Resources and Environment.
Green transition is a key policy for Vietnam and is stipulated in government statements and documents towards the goal of net zero emissions by 2050. It is estimated that Vietnam will have to mobilize $368-380 billion until 2040, equivalent to 6.8% of GDP every year, to make the green transition and tackle climate change.
Despite the great potential, the current green credit and green bond market in Vietnam is facing challenges, including those related to mechanisms/policies and collaboration between ministries in issuing the national green taxonomy.
The event will feature officials from the Ministry of Natural Resources and Environment, the Ministry of Finance, the Ministry of Planning and Investment, the State Bank of Vietnam, financial-economic experts, banks, stock brokerages, businesses, credit rating organizations, international institutions, and the press.
The seminar is to take place at No. 65, Van Mieu street, Dong Da district, Hanoi.
